BUSINESS DEVELOPMENT DIRECTOR, TECHNOLOGY & LIFE SCIENCES

The Business Development Director is responsible for driving market growth, revenue generation, and long-term client partnerships in support of McGough's corporate growth and profitability goals. This role develops new client relationships while strengthening existing partnerships across the Technology and Life Sciences sectors.

The Director serves as a strategic market leader, aligning national and regional business development initiatives with the company's overall growth strategy. This position collaborates closely with Operations, Preconstruction, Marketing, and national and regional leadership to lead pursuits, generate accurate pipeline forecasts, and position McGough competitively within the marketplace.

In alignment with our commitment to pay transparency, the base salary range for this position is $110,000 to $210,000, excluding fringe benefits or potential bonuses. If you join McGough, your final base salary will be determined by several factors, including geography, location, skills, education, and experience. Furthermore, we place significant value on pay equity among our current team members as part of any final job offer.

Please note that the range provided above reflects the hiring range for this role. Hiring near the top end of this range would be atypical, as we aim to allow room for future salary growth. Additionally, McGough offers a comprehensive compensation and benefits package. This includes insurance coverage for medical, dental, vision, life, and disability. We also provide generous retirement plans, voluntary benefit plans, parental leave, substantial paid time off, and holiday pay.
